Job summary

Jobtailor in Cambridge, MA is seeking a strategic Project Manager to drive Medical Affairs operations, end-to-end study support, and cross-functional alignment with CROs and internal teams.

The role focuses on planning budgets, dashboards, SOPs, and communications tools to enable rapid growth in a highly regulated pharmaceutical environment.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ree required; advanced degree preferred.
  • Minimum of 5 years of relevant operational experience in the pharmaceutical or biotech industry.
  • Project management and resource planning/management experience; PMP or other project management certification is a plus.
  • Minimum of 8 years of company sponsored study management experience within Clinical Operations or Medical Affairs or combination.
  • Strong knowledge of and ability to implement Medical Affairs concepts and operational practices.
  • Proven experience managing and interacting with medical affairs vendors.
  • Ability to represent Medical Affairs project management activities with broader Project Management and cross-functional teams.
  • Strong cross-functional collaboration skills.
  • Proficiency in project management software and tools and Microsoft Office Suite; experience with Smartsheet.
  • Excellent written, verbal, and communication skills.
  • Ability to work independently, prioritize complex information, and problem solve.
  • Ability to thrive in a fast-paced environment, handle multiple activities, prioritize, and pivot as necessary.
  • Ability to travel 10–20%

Responsibilities

  • Provide strategic project management support across Medical Affairs and cross-functionally.
  • Manage Company Sponsored Phase 4 study operations end to end, including CRO oversight and cross-functional alignment.
  • Operationalize Medical Affairs planning, including budget planning with Medical Directors.
  • Support congress planning, reports, and congress-specific training materials.
  • Maintain Medical Affairs SharePoint databases, budgets, medical resources, and departmental report repositories.
  • Create project timelines, monitor strategic project progress, and ensure deliverables are completed on time and within budget.
  • Support advisory boards, publications, and congress meetings.
  • Lead development of the monthly Medical Affairs dashboard.
  • Maintain calendars of program, congress, and internal meetings.
  • Plan, implement, and maintain departmental platforms.
  • Maintain quarterly business updates and support preparation for Executive Leadership Team and Senior Leadership Team presentations.
  • Author and maintain Medical Affairs operating processes and SOPs, ensuring audit- and launch-readiness.
  • Build operating processes and systems in a fast-moving, high-growth environment.
  • Establish process improvements, incorporate new technologies, and develop communication tools for cross-functional partners.
  • Support publication processes and create materials for internal meetings using PowerPoint, Smartsheet, and other tools
